![]() Hi, I've been using limewire for a while now and i am having a little problem. When i try to download movie's with a size of 500MB or more, it will never start. It will just keep going on to finding more sources and stuff like that even with 50+ users. When i try to download something with less than 300 MB they work and i get great speeds. Can anyone please help me with this problem? |
| ||||
![]() There are fake files on the network which won't ever download...they'll sit connecting for a while then go to 'need more sources'. Maybe these are what you're seeing? Very often, these fakes show a huge number of sources. Always check a file with Bitzi before download (click on link for more info) How to use Bitzi Search again, vary your search terms. Go for a file with 10 sources or less, or those with a modem source (providing the Bitzi rating is ok:wink ![]() A file with heaps of sources but no Bitzi rating is often a fake. |
